You may not have heard of us before, but you’ve almost certainly heard of the products we help bring to players throughout the Prairie Provinces and the North every day; lottery games like LOTTO 6/49, SPORT SELECT, and dozens of instant scratch tickets. 

WCLC is the non-profit organization authorized to manage, conduct, and operate lotteries – at retail and online – and other gaming-related activities for the governments of Alberta, Saskatchewan, and Manitoba as well as the Yukon, Northwest Territories, and Nunavut. We work closely with our provincial partners to bring a first-rate lottery experience to our players and meet their changing needs with new technology and tools.
